A Regional Engineering College plans to become a smart college by applying IoT concepts. How can each of the following be implemented in order to transform the college into an IoT-enabled smart college?

  • E-textbooks
  • Smart boards
  • Online tests
  • Wi-fi sensors on classroom doors
  • Sensors in buses to monitor their location
  • Wearables (watches or smart belts) for attendance monitoring

Answer

  1. E-textbooks — Develop or subscribe to an e-learning platform where students can access e-textbooks and other digital resources.
  2. Smart boards — Install smart boards in classrooms that can connect to the internet and display interactive content.
  3. Online tests — Develop or adopt an online testing platform that ensures secure and fair testing conditions.
  4. Wi-fi sensors on classroom doors — Install Wi-Fi-enabled sensors on classroom doors to monitor entry and exit, ensuring security and tracking attendance.
  5. Sensors in buses to monitor their location — Equip buses with GPS sensors to monitor their location in real time.
  6. Wearables (watches or smart belts) for attendance monitoring — Use RFID-enabled wearables for students and staff to automate attendance tracking.
